HaloTag Fusion Enables Dynamic Analysis of Prion Protein Biosynthesis, Turnover, and Misfolding
Prion protein (PrP) misfolding underlies fatal neurodegenerative diseases. We developed a HaloTag‐based PrP fusion enabling spatiotemporal labeling of distinct PrP populations in living cells. This system recapitulates native PrP biology, reveals early misfolding events in disease‐associated mutants, and allows mechanistic interrogation of PrP‐lowering

A Systematic Comparison of Alpha‐Synuclein Seed Amplification Assays for Increasing Reproducibility
ABSTRACT Seed amplification assays (SAAs) enable ultrasensitive detection of misfolded α‐synuclein across biofluids and tissues. Yet, heterogeneity in protocols limits cross‐study comparability and clinical translation. Here, we review α‐synuclein SAA methods and their performance across various biological matrices.

RNF213 is characterized as a dual‐functional antiviral effector. It directly mediates the degradation of the influenza A virus nucleoprotein (NP) while simultaneously activating the MDA5‐mediated innate immune signaling pathway.
